All,

I am now taking pre-orders for CC gear and plan to make an initial order for about 30 t-shirts. I expect the cost of these shirts to be $13.99 + shipping to your door. A rough version of the shirts is below, but I would like your feed back before finalizing the design. Over the years we have used cafe press to handle some of this, but I feel that their prices hold our users back from wanting to purchase these items. If we order in large enough quantities the pricing does improve, and these costs will be passed onto you.

Depending on the success of the shirts, I will also place an order for hoodies. If you want something else custom, please reply to this topic and I will see what we can come up with.
